[0001] This utility model relates to the field of conveying equipment technology, specifically a chain plate conveyor with adjustable conveying speed. Background Technology
[0002] Chain conveyors are common conveying equipment. A chain conveyor is a type of conveyor that uses standard chain plates as the bearing surface. Multiple rows of chain plates can be made to be very wide and form a differential speed. By utilizing the speed difference of multiple rows of chain plates, multiple rows of conveying can be transformed into single-row conveying without compression.
[0003] Chain conveyors are transmission devices mainly powered by motors and reducers. The conveying speed of chain conveyors is inconvenient to adjust and change, which affects the flexibility and stability of the conveying process. Moreover, the gaps between the chain plates on the surface of common chain conveyors are difficult to clean, which affects the safety of subsequent use.
[0004] There is an urgent need for a chain conveyor with adjustable conveying speed to solve the technical defects mentioned above. Utility Model Content

[0012] Compared with the prior art, the beneficial effects of this utility model are: the adjustable speed chain conveyor not only realizes the functions of easy speed adjustment and easy cleaning, but also the functions of easy limit positioning;
[0013] (1) The conveyor belt is equipped with a chain plate conveyor belt, a conveyor motor, a gearbox, a first gear shaft, a second gear shaft, a mounting cylinder and mounting bolts. The conveyor motor drives the chain plate conveyor belt through the gear inside the gearbox. When it is necessary to change the conveying speed of the chain plate conveyor belt, the gearbox can be opened and the internal gear set can be replaced. When replacing, the first gear shaft and the second gear shaft inside the gearbox can be disassembled and replaced. This structure realizes the speed adjustment function by replacing the gear set, which improves the flexibility and stability of the conveyor belt.
[0014] (2) By setting up a vacuum suction machine, support frame, collection box, connecting pipe, filter screen, drive motor and cleaning brush roller, when it is necessary to clean the chain conveyor belt, first turn on the vacuum suction machine. The vacuum suction machine sucks the dust on the chain conveyor belt into the inside of the collection box by vacuum suction. At the same time, the drive motor drives the cleaning brush roller to rotate and brush the surface of the chain conveyor belt. The dust and impurities brushed off enter the inside of the collection box through the connecting pipe and are collected by the filter screen. This structure realizes the function of easy cleaning.
[0015] (3) By setting up a chain conveyor belt, a limiting plate, a fixing plate and an adjusting screw, the limiting plate on the chain conveyor belt can limit the conveying of objects on the conveyor belt. The distance between the two sets of limiting plates can be adjusted according to the requirements. When adjusting, the adjusting screw can be held and rotated. The adjusting screw can push the limiting plate to move and adjust on the chain conveyor belt. This structure realizes the function of easy limiting. Attached Figure Description

[0029] Working principle: The conveyor motor 7 drives the chain conveyor belt 3 through the gears inside the gearbox 8. During the conveying process, the limiting plate 4 can limit the conveying of objects on the conveyor belt. The distance between the two sets of limiting plates 4 can be adjusted as needed. During adjustment, the adjusting screw 6 can be held and rotated. The adjusting screw 6 can push the limiting plate 4 to move and adjust on the chain conveyor belt 3. When it is necessary to change the conveying speed of the chain conveyor belt 3, the gearbox 8 can be opened and the internal gear set can be replaced. During replacement, the first gear shaft 16 and the second gear shaft 17 inside the gearbox 8 can be disassembled and replaced. This structure achieves speed adjustment function by replacing the gear set. When it is necessary to clean the chain conveyor belt 3, the vacuum suction machine 9 is turned on first. The vacuum suction machine 9 sucks the dust on the chain conveyor belt 3 into the collection box 11 through vacuum suction. At the same time, the drive motor 14 drives the cleaning brush roller 15 to rotate and brush the surface of the chain conveyor belt 3. The dust and impurities brushed off enter the collection box 11 through the connecting pipe 12 and are collected by the filter screen 13. This structure realizes the function of easy cleaning.
